Handover Note — Franchise Agreement, Ostrell Foods

To the incoming director and heads of department: the Marbeck franchise agreement renews in Q3. Royalty terms renegotiated; territory exclusivity for the Welling district confirmed. Outstanding items: signage compliance audit, training schedule for new operators. Keep the Penbrook group at arm's length until signatures land. Context on where this fits in the wider plan is appended below.

board note of kageg-bahof: The renewal with Holwynax Holdings closes at $2 million a year, 5 percent below the last contract. Project Ulaath slips by two quarters because of the supplier delay.

## Step 4: Repoint the LiftLogic simulator

After the dispatch tables finish replicating, switch the LiftLogic elevator-dispatch simulator to the new Carroway cluster. Drain in-flight simulation runs first; interrupted runs will not resume cleanly and must be requeued. Once drained, stop the scheduler, update the runtime settings, and restart in validation mode. Compare hall-call latency against the baseline report before opening traffic. The settings the simulator should be started with in the new cluster are listed below.

config for kafof-bawef:
holath:
  log_level: debug
  metrics_host: metrics.holath.qorvelsys.internal
  pin: 2191
  pool_size: 32

Handover — Support Outsourcing Plan

Hi team — quick note as I pass this to Director Petra Vane. The plan to shift tier-one support to Claroden Services is mostly baked: contract drafted, SLAs agreed at 92% first-response, transition pencilled for autumn. Still open: retention packages for the Oakhurst support crew and the escalation workflow. Petra owns it from here; route questions her way. The confidential plan note is right below.

internal memo for kawip-hadug: Headcount on the Wenwyn team goes from 7 to 140 by the end of January. Gross margin on Wenwyn came in at 20 percent against a plan of 15 percent.

Quick one before the sync: the Migrato service account expired Tuesday, which is why the zero-downtime schema migration on the ledger tables stalled at step 4 of 9. Nothing rolled back — the dual-write shim is still in place, so both old and new columns are getting data. I've re-issued credentials and confirmed the backfill job resumes cleanly in staging. Plan is to finish steps 5–9 tonight during the low-traffic window. For anyone picking this up, the migration runner authenticates with this key:

service key, fawip-bajef: kto11_Qt5wZK9vdNC